Director, Sales Operations - M5 (SLSOPS - Sales Operations)

Remote Full-time
Overview

The Director, Sales Automation will be an influential, experienced leader, responsible for leading the sales automation and AI efforts in the Sales organization. This role will be responsible for leveraging SFDC to enhance our sales processes, increase effectiveness and support our Sales teams' productivity, working in close partnership with the Enterprise Applications team. This role demands a blend of strategic vision, technical expertise, and leadership to innovate, implement, and optimize sales automation tools. This person will manage a team supporting these efforts as well. Successful candidates will have a strong background in Salesforce Platform Management and Administration, be proactive, curious and innovative, and excited about driving productivity and effectiveness through sales technology.

Responsibilities

Essential duties and responsibilitie
• Develop and implement a long-term strategy for sales automation to enhance sales productivity from lead generation to closing, aligning to business targets and identify KPIs to measure success.
• Collaborate with Sales Leadership and Reps to understand pain points and identify automation opportunities and integrate them into the sales process to reduce manual and or many-click tasks.
• Analyze sales processes for inefficiencies and recommend/implement solutions using SFDC and other sales automation tools.
• Understand the needs and challenges of the sales teams, the mechanisms by which the cross-functional departments interact with sales automation and information, and tailor solutions that verifiably improve workflow and outcomes.
• Practice innovation daily and look for new ways to use Salesforce to gain a competitive advantage, whether through automation, AI or other emerging technologies.
• Make decisions based on analytics, metrics and leadership guidance to ensure automation efforts and AI are genuinely increasing outcomes and results.
• Manage projects, tasks, timelines, implementation of innovations, as well as team resources smoothly from start to finish.
• Build a strong alliance with Business Application leadership and convey Sales priorities, challenges, and needed support.
• Demonstrate patience, perseverance and grit in a complex and ever-changing environment.
• In collaboration with cross-functional partners, manage all product backlog related to Sales, including roadmap development and operating as product owner (i.e. development and priority of user stories, testing)
• Responsible for ensuring communications and change management related to releases, demonstrations, and working with the Sales Enablement team for relevant enablement on enhancements.

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ications
• Ideal target experience of 5-10 years of CRM product management experience, with at least 3 years specifically focused on Salesforce.com and including Lightening.
• Experience with other Sales Automation and tools preferred, such as outreach/prospecting, sales enablement, revenue intelligence, conversational intelligence.
• Deep technical proficiency in SFDC Sales Cloud, CPQ (Logik.io) and integrations with boundary applications is important, including customization, integration, and data management.
• Strong understanding of agile development practices and experience working within a change management and project framework.
Ability to evaluate and prioritize solutions based on business needs and technical feasibility.
• Excellent at explaining complex systems in simple terms to stakeholders at all levels, including conveying the value of automation to non-technical team members.
• Strong problem-solving skills to address and resolve issues.
• Prior management experience preferred.

A reasonable estimate of the base compensation range for this position is $124,800 - $189,200 USD. This compensation range is specific to the United States and it incorporates many factors including but not limited to an applicant's skills and prior relevant experience and training; licensures, degrees, and certifications; specific geographic location; internal equity; internal pay ranges; and market data/range parameters.
